Bursting with potential is this four double bedroom detached family home which boasts spacious living accommodation throughout and briefly comprises of a welcoming entrance hallway, spacious lounge diner, breakfast kitchen, conservatory, handy ground floor w.c, four well presented double bedrooms, attractive shower room, good size loft, attached garage ripe for conversion, beautifully landscaped gardens backing on to park land and a block paved driveway. Within walking distance to Almondbury village centre which benefits from local amenities including shops, restaurants, cafes, boutiques, pharmacy, doctor's surgery, well regarded schools, Castle Hill and countryside walks.
